端到端 节点展开与闭合拆分出流程层级与活动层级两类

This commit is contained in:
ouyang 2023-07-30 10:15:49 +08:00
parent b56031417f
commit 291ecaa793
8 changed files with 8 additions and 8 deletions

View File

@ -27,9 +27,9 @@ public interface SubProcessConst {
String RELATION_FRAMEWORK = "relation_framework";
// 子流程图形宽度
double SUB_PROCESS_SHAPE_W = 100.0;
double SUB_PROCESS_SHAPE_W = 150.0;
// 子流程图形高度
double SUB_PROCESS_SHAPE_H = 70.0;
double SUB_PROCESS_SHAPE_H = 66.0;
// 图形间垂直间隔
double SHAPE_VERT_INTERVAL = 80.0;

View File

@ -126,7 +126,7 @@ public class GraphLayout {
double w = Arrays.stream(position).mapToDouble(position -> position[0]).max().orElse(0.0);
double h = Arrays.stream(position).mapToDouble(position -> position[1]).max().orElse(0.0);
this.canvasWidth = w + 200.0;
this.canvasWidth = w + 300.0;
this.canvasHeight = h + 200.0;
// 打印节点坐标与画布大小

View File

@ -13,4 +13,4 @@
var mainType = "<#mainType>";
var uid = "<#uid>";
var wHref = "./w";
var jdHref = "./jd";</script><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-08487bf0.283a9f57.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-1abee27b.c5c7126f.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-2933a75e.38619268.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-480b7580.53f41558.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-4cc17289.6298c290.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-591a3298.d3570084.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-6fb6e04f.adde4cab.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-9c63e2da.ef0a5aa8.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-cd54d348.e55cad48.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-08487bf0.f2d21617.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-1abee27b.b80e6063.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2933a75e.1e77fa38.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d0ab156.fa4db24d.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d0f078a.99efbc15.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d212b99.89ae9070.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d216d3a.74924585.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d224b23.0c24bb7f.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d224ef1.fd7162ac.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-3178e2bf.ca905c87.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-3a9b7577.aa0dfa28.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-480b7580.e2852da7.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-4cc17289.7698c7f2.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-591a3298.8f5c1020.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-6fb6e04f.297d7f10.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-9c63e2da.26936c6a.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-cd54d348.1f56b602.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/app.20eb2063.css rel=preload as=style><link href=../apps/com.actionsoft.apps.coe.pal/main/js/app.11731e9b.js rel=preload as=script><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-vendors.cecfe522.js rel=preload as=script><link href=../apps/com.actionsoft.apps.coe.pal/main/css/app.20eb2063.css rel=stylesheet></head><body style=margin:0;><div id=app></div><script src=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-vendors.cecfe522.js></script><script src=../apps/com.actionsoft.apps.coe.pal/main/js/app.11731e9b.js></script></body></html>
var jdHref = "./jd";</script><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-08487bf0.283a9f57.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-1abee27b.c5c7126f.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-2933a75e.38619268.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-4cc17289.6298c290.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-591a3298.d3570084.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-6fb6e04f.adde4cab.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-733cd76d.806eeab0.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-9c63e2da.ef0a5aa8.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/chunk-cd54d348.e55cad48.css r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-08487bf0.f2d21617.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-1abee27b.b80e6063.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2933a75e.1e77fa38.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d0ab156.fa4db24d.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d0f078a.99efbc15.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d212b99.89ae9070.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d216d3a.74924585.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d224b23.0c24bb7f.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-2d224ef1.fd7162ac.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-3178e2bf.ca905c87.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-3a9b7577.aa0dfa28.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-4cc17289.7698c7f2.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-591a3298.8f5c1020.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-6fb6e04f.297d7f10.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-733cd76d.957d1b9a.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-9c63e2da.26936c6a.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-cd54d348.1f56b602.js rel=prefetch><link href=../apps/com.actionsoft.apps.coe.pal/main/css/app.20eb2063.css rel=preload as=style><link href=../apps/com.actionsoft.apps.coe.pal/main/js/app.9f0fe84c.js rel=preload as=script><link href=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-vendors.cecfe522.js rel=preload as=script><link href=../apps/com.actionsoft.apps.coe.pal/main/css/app.20eb2063.css rel=stylesheet></head><body style=margin:0;><div id=app></div><script src=../apps/com.actionsoft.apps.coe.pal/main/js/chunk-vendors.cecfe522.js></script><script src=../apps/com.actionsoft.apps.coe.pal/main/js/app.9f0fe84c.js></script></body></html>

File diff suppressed because one or more lines are too long